The Commander

Whenever a creature an opponent controls attacks, if you're the defending player, create a 3/3 red Ogre creature token unless that creature's controller pays {3}.

Guide

Gameplan

Kazuul punishes opponents for attacking you by spitting out 3/3 Ogre tokens, then you flip those tokens into a swarm of attackers and aristocrat fodder. You play a politics-heavy goad/punisher game, forcing opponents into your defenses while building a board, then close with a big alpha strike or sacrifice payoffs. Turn to turn you incentivize attacks elsewhere or directly at you to bank tokens.

Strengths

  • Generates free 3/3 tokens that snowball board presence with no mana investment
  • Excellent in multiplayer politics, deterring attacks and punishing aggressive opponents
  • Pairs naturally with goad effects to weaponize opponents' own creatures into your token engine
  • Tokens enable aristocrats, go-wide, and sacrifice strategies in mono-red

Weaknesses

  • Only triggers when opponents attack YOU, so passive tables produce nothing
  • The {3} tax can be paid by mana-rich opponents to deny tokens
  • Mono-red lacks card draw and recovery from board wipes
  • Removal of Kazuul shuts off the entire engine; needs protection or recast plans

Key Cards

  • Disrupt Decorum — Goads every opponent's creatures, forcing waves of attacks that mint Kazuul tokens.
  • Grand Melee — Forces all creatures to attack each turn, turning the whole table into your token factory.
  • Impact Tremors — Each Ogre token entering pings every opponent, converting tokens into direct damage.
  • Purphoros, God of the Forge — Turns the constant stream of Ogre tokens into a relentless burn clock and sacrifice payoff.
  • Goblin Bombardment — Sacrifices excess Ogres for guaranteed damage and removal at instant speed.
  • Brutal Hordechief — Lifeswing and a goad-like attack tax that synergizes with your token army.

Upgrade Path

Lean harder into forced-attack enablers like Disrupt Decorum, Grand Melee, and Hissing Iguanar to maximize triggers, then add token payoffs (Purphoros, Impact Tremors, Krenko-style multipliers) and sacrifice outlets. Improve mono-red's weaknesses with card advantage from Outpost Siege, Faithless Looting effects, and treasure-based ramp like Dockside Extortionist; protect Kazuul with Bloodthirster of haste and recursion such as Feldon of the Third Path. Add a fast finisher like Craterhoof Behemoth or Pathbreaker Ibex to convert your wide board into a one-shot kill.

Win Conditions

  • ▸Alpha strike with a wide board of Ogres pumped by anthems or Craterhoof-style effects
  • ▸Drain the table with Impact Tremors, Purphoros, or Goblin Bombardment off endless tokens
  • ▸Goad opponents into each other while your Ogre army outvalues and finishes survivors

Archetypes

  • Tokens / Go-Wide — Kazuul builds an army of 3/3 Ogres for free that overrun the table with anthems and haste.
  • Goad / Politics — Forcing opponents to attack you turns their creatures into your token engine while shaping the table.
  • Aristocrats — Free Ogre tokens are perfect sacrifice fodder for damage and value payoffs in mono-red.
  • Punisher / Pillowfort — Kazuul taxes and deters attacks, defending you while filling the board.
